Output 8a15457fe76e2ee2792957376bc92d39b465cca9d89e7b97cdfb5f9b9bab94bf:2

value
14009650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ec8ede875b6bf17c15aff1bf38044066b12d9d OP_EQUAL
address
3QCdY5Tx8ppHSZsi3SSaYZnpFvo1mrWdAb
transaction
8a15457fe76e2ee2792957376bc92d39b465cca9d89e7b97cdfb5f9b9bab94bf
confirmations
93875
spent
true